We were able to get a once over on our trailer and there were no major surprises other than what we had already surmised with our limited knowledge. The dreaded black water tank may not be holding and we are assessing today whether we are going to need to replace it. PO replaced plumbing with pvc, so we are going to change that out to pex. We also have some separation at rear bumper, but it's not major where it has to be tended to right this minute. Bathroom floor is solid enough for the time being. I'm going to paint bathroom with marine paint to spiff it up, and then at some point when we are ready to tear it up and redo, we'll tend to the separation. For the time being the main thing is to get it where we can live it it for a few months while we remodel our house.
